jan awruturğa
/dʒan awruturʁa/
Literal translation
to make one's soul ache
Intended meaning
To feel compassion for someone and treat them with kindness; to take someone's part out of sympathy.
- İy, nek dep sorsağız, kerti duşman açısa, biz anı açığanŋa sanamaybız. Aŋa jan awrutmaybız.Hey, since you ask why — when a real enemy is hurt, we do not count it as being hurt. We feel no pity for him.
- Sen meni egeçimse. Anı sebepli, bu malğunla saŋa da jan awrutmazla.You are my sister. For that reason these scoundrels will feel no pity for you either.
